FAQs About Unnamed (No.HA767) Heritage Agreement
What is the best season to walk in Unnamed Heritage Agreement in McCracken, Australia?
The best season to walk in Unnamed Heritage Agreement in McCracken, Australia is during the spring and autumn months. These seasons offer milder temperatures and less rainfall, making it more comfortable for walking and hiking.
What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Unnamed Heritage Agreement in McCracken, Australia?
The typical weather conditions in Unnamed Heritage Agreement in McCracken, Australia include hot summers with temperatures reaching up to 35°C (95°F) and mild winters with temperatures averaging around 15°C (59°F). It's important to prepare for hot and dry conditions, especially in the summer months.
What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Unnamed Heritage Agreement in McCracken, Australia?
While walking or hiking in Unnamed Heritage Agreement in McCracken, Australia, you may encounter a variety of wildlife including kangaroos, wallabies, echidnas, and a diverse range of bird species. It's important to be respectful of the wildlife and maintain a safe distance while observing them.
